What does the 55490bingusshush emoji mean?
Bingus is telling you to keep it down with a shush.
This emoji features the internet-famous hairless cat, Bingus, making a shushing gesture. It is widely used in Discord servers to playfully silence a chat, signal that a secret is being shared, or simply to react to someone being too loud or chaotic.
When to use it
- Telling a loud user to be quiet
- Signaling that a secret is being shared
- Reacting to someone saying something controversial
- Playfully shushing a chaotic group chat

How to add this emoji
Add to Discord
- Click Download PNG above to save the 55490bingusshush image.
- Open Discord and go to Server Settings → Emoji.
- Click Upload Emoji and choose the downloaded file.
- Give it a name and save. You need the Manage Emojis and Stickers permission.
